Bariatric Surgery
• Obesity; It is a disease that is increasingly seen all over the world, described as the "disease of the age" and can cause life-threatening problems.
• Gastric sleeve and other weight-loss surgeries — known collectively as bariatric surgery — involve making changes to your digestive system to help you lose weight.
• Bariatric surgery is done when diet and exercise haven't worked or when you have serious health problems because of your weight.
• Some procedures limit how much you can eat. Other procedures work by reducing the body's ability to absorb nutrients. Some procedures do both.
• While bariatric surgery can offer many benefits, all forms of weight-loss surgery are major procedures that can pose serious risks and side effects. Also, you must make permanent healthy changes to your diet and get regular exercise to help ensure the long-term success of bariatric surgery.
Types of Bariatric Surgery
Gastric Sleeve
• Gastric Sleeve Surgery, or vertical sleeve Gastrectomy (VSG), reduces the size of the stomach by removing about 80% of its capacity. Patients experience rapid weight loss results and have more control to live healthier and maintain a slimmer body.
• Restriction in stomach capacity: Limits food intake and feel full from smaller sized portions.
• Reduction of hunger hormones: Significantly reduces Ghrelin in the stomach so you feel less hungry.
• Improves satiety hormones: Increased sensitivity to Leptin (protein) responsible for feeling full.
Gastric Bypass
• Gastric bypass is a fast, powerful, and long-term solution to fighting obesity by changing the body’s metabolic thermostat. Patients can lose about 78% of their excess body weight in 1.5 years after surgery.
• Restriction in new stomach pouch: It limits food intake and gives a feeling of satiety in smaller portions.
• Malabsorption in calories absorbed: It provides an effective solution in the treatment of obesity by providing less absorption of calories from food.
Gastric Balloon
In the Gastric Balloon procedure, a balloon is inflated in the stomach to temporarily decrease the stomach capacity/volume and induce weight loss. The goal of this procedure is to be somewhere in between major weight loss surgery and dieting/exercise. The gastric balloon works best with a structured program and lifestyle changes.
Differences Between Sleeve and Bypass
Gastric Sleeve
• Stomach size is reduced
• Suitable for patients over BMI 30+
• Low risk of complications
• Short recovery time
• Short-term medication use
• Vitamin mineral absorption continues
• Less Ghrelin release
• It is beneficial for the sugar level of diabetic patients
Gastric Bypass
• Stomach is bypassed and connected with the small intestine
• Suitable for patients over BMI 50+
• High risk of complications
• Long recovery time
• Lifetime vitamin and mineral requirement
• Very small amounts of vitamins and minerals are taken from meals
• Ghrelin release continues
• More beneficial for reflux and diabetes patients
• Dumping syndrome risk
